Which energy system provides long-term energy lasting more than 2 minutes?

Explanation:
Understanding how energy is supplied during exercise shows why the aerobic/oxidative system fits long-term, >2 minutes activity. This system uses oxygen to drive the mitochondrial processes (Krebs cycle and electron transport chain), burning carbohydrates or fats to produce ATP. Because it relies on oxygen, it can sustain ATP production for extended periods, from several minutes to hours, which is why endurance and endurance-strength activities lean on it. The trade-off is rate versus total output: the aerobic system can generate a large amount of ATP, but not as quickly as the immediate or glycolytic systems. Those other systems are designed for short bursts of high power—the ATP-PC system for roughly the first 10 seconds and the glycolytic system for roughly up to 2 minutes. Once the pace lasts longer than a couple minutes, the body shifts to aerobic metabolism to maintain energy production. So, for energy lasting more than about two minutes, the aerobic/oxidative system is the primary source.
